# Break-Glass: Catalog Cache Invalidation

Scope: the Pinrow product catalog at Veldstone Retail. If stale prices persist after a purge and the Hollowmere invalidation queue is wedged, use break-glass to flush the edge tier directly. Contractors: get verbal sign-off from the catalog lead first. Steps: open the Hollowmere admin shell, select emergency-flush, confirm the tenant, and run it once — repeated flushes thrash the origin. Access is logged and expires after 20 minutes. Unseal the admin shell with the passphrase below.

recovery phrase for kahop-tajog: istix-casvan

The renewal of our three-year agreement with Torvane Materials has been assessed in detail. Proposed terms include a 4.2% unit-price increase, partially offset by improved volume rebates and extended payment terms of sixty days. Sensitivity analysis indicates a net annual cost impact of under 1% on the Meridia product line, assuming stable demand. Legal has flagged no material changes to liability clauses. We recommend approval, subject to the conditions outlined in the confidential note below.

confidential, yawip-bahif: Zorokox Partners plans to lower the Casax list price by 28.0 percent in April. The board signed off on a budget of $271.0 million for Project Juldor. The renewal with Pelokox Partners closes at $410.1 million a year, 3.4 percent below the last contract. Project Pelok slips by a full year because of the audit delay.

Handover for the weekly eng sync — stale-cache postmortem (Pondermill checkout service). Root cause confirmed: TTL misread on the edge layer; fix shipped and verified. Remaining action: rotate the cache-admin credentials, which requires unsealing the ops vault that locked during the incident. I didn't get to it. Whoever picks this up, unseal it with the recovery passphrase directly below.

unlock words, tagaf-hahif: ralwyn-lammir-rusax-sormir

Quick one for the weekly sync: the Marrowdb migration that partitions `events` by month failed its signature check in CI last night. Turns out the migration signer still uses the old Hollyfork key, so everything it stamps gets rejected. Fix is just re-signing the partitioning script with the current key, pasted below.

rollout seal: bky4_x7Gc